news 2026/4/18 7:05:34

零配置运行阿里达摩院模型,科哥镜像让ASR更简单

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
零配置运行阿里达摩院模型,科哥镜像让ASR更简单

零配置运行阿里达摩院模型,科哥镜像让ASR更简单

1. 背景与技术价值

随着语音识别技术在会议记录、智能客服、语音输入等场景的广泛应用,高效、准确且易于部署的中文语音识别(ASR)系统成为开发者和企业的刚需。阿里巴巴达摩院推出的Paraformer模型作为非自回归端到端语音识别框架的代表,在多个公开数据集上实现了SOTA效果,具备高精度、低延迟的优势。

然而,从零搭建 Paraformer 推理环境涉及复杂的依赖安装、模型下载与服务部署流程,对新手极不友好。为此,由社区开发者“科哥”构建的Speech Seaco Paraformer ASR 镜像应运而生——它将完整的推理环境、WebUI界面与优化配置打包成一键可运行的容器镜像,真正实现“零配置启动”,极大降低了使用门槛。

该镜像基于 ModelScope 上的speech_seaco_paraformer_large_asr_nat-zh-cn-16k-common-vocab8404-pytorch模型进行封装,并集成热词增强、批量处理、实时录音识别等功能,适用于教育、法律、医疗、会议纪要等多种专业场景。


2. 核心功能解析

2.1 支持多模式语音识别

镜像内置 WebUI 界面,提供四大核心功能模块,覆盖绝大多数实际应用需求:

功能模块使用场景
单文件识别上传单个音频文件进行转录
批量处理多个录音文件批量转换为文本
实时录音利用麦克风即时语音转文字
系统信息查看模型状态与硬件资源

这种设计使得用户无需编写代码即可完成完整的工作流操作,特别适合非技术人员快速上手。

2.2 热词定制提升关键术语识别率

SeACoParaformer 模型最大的优势在于其解耦式热词激励机制。相比传统方案中热词嵌入影响整体解码过程的问题,SeACoParaformer 通过后验概率融合方式独立控制热词增强逻辑,做到“可见可控”。

在 WebUI 中只需在指定输入框中填入以逗号分隔的关键词,即可显著提升特定词汇的召回率。例如:

人工智能,深度学习,大模型,Transformer,预训练

这一特性在专业领域尤为关键:

  • 医疗场景:CT扫描、核磁共振、病理诊断
  • 法律场景:原告、被告、证据链、判决书
  • 科技会议:GPU算力、LoRA微调、上下文长度

实验表明,在加入相关热词后,专业术语识别准确率平均提升15%-30%

2.3 多格式音频兼容与高性能推理

支持主流音频格式包括.wav,.mp3,.flac,.m4a,.aac,.ogg,推荐使用 16kHz 采样率的无损格式(如 WAV 或 FLAC)以获得最佳识别质量。

得益于非自回归架构的设计,模型推理速度可达5-6 倍实时(RTF_avg ≈ 0.17~0.2),即一段 1 分钟的音频仅需约 10~12 秒即可完成识别,远超传统自回归模型(通常 RTF > 1)。


3. 快速部署与使用指南

3.1 启动服务

该镜像已预装所有依赖项,启动命令极为简洁:

/bin/bash /root/run.sh

执行该脚本后,系统会自动拉起 FastAPI 后端与 Gradio 前端服务,默认监听端口7860

3.2 访问 WebUI 界面

打开浏览器并访问以下地址:

http://localhost:7860

若需远程访问,请替换localhost为服务器 IP 地址:

http://<服务器IP>:7860

首次加载可能需要等待数秒,随后即可进入图形化操作界面。


4. 四大功能模块详解

4.1 单文件识别

使用流程
  1. 点击「选择音频文件」按钮上传本地音频;
  2. (可选)调整批处理大小(batch size),建议保持默认值 1;
  3. (可选)输入热词列表,提高特定词汇识别准确率;
  4. 点击「🚀 开始识别」按钮;
  5. 查看输出文本及详细信息(置信度、处理耗时、处理速度等);
  6. 完成后点击「🗑️ 清空」重置界面。
输出示例
识别文本:今天我们讨论人工智能的发展趋势以及大模型在实际业务中的落地挑战。 --- 详细信息: - 置信度: 95.00% - 音频时长: 45.23 秒 - 处理耗时: 7.65 秒 - 处理速度: 5.91x 实时

提示:单个音频建议不超过 5 分钟(最长支持 300 秒),否则可能导致显存溢出或响应延迟。

4.2 批量处理

适用于会议系列录音、访谈合集等多文件转录任务。

操作步骤
  1. 点击「选择多个音频文件」,支持多选;
  2. 设置热词(可选);
  3. 点击「🚀 批量识别」开始处理;
  4. 结果以表格形式展示,包含文件名、识别文本、置信度和处理时间。
输出示例
文件名识别文本置信度处理时间
meeting_001.mp3今天我们讨论...95%7.6s
meeting_002.mp3下一个议题是...93%6.8s
meeting_003.mp3最后总结一下...96%8.2s

限制说明

  • 单次最多上传 20 个文件
  • 总大小建议不超过 500MB
  • 大文件将排队依次处理

4.3 实时录音识别

适合即兴发言记录、课堂讲解、语音笔记等实时转写场景。

使用方法
  1. 点击麦克风图标,浏览器请求麦克风权限(请允许);
  2. 开始说话,保持语速适中、发音清晰;
  3. 再次点击停止录音;
  4. 点击「🚀 识别录音」触发识别;
  5. 查看结果并复制保存。

注意:首次使用需授权麦克风权限;建议在安静环境中使用以减少背景噪音干扰。

4.4 系统信息监控

点击「🔄 刷新信息」可查看当前运行状态,便于排查问题或评估性能瓶颈。

显示内容

🤖 模型信息

  • 模型名称:speech_seaco_paraformer_large_asr_nat-zh-cn-16k-common-vocab8404-pytorch
  • 模型路径:/models/paraformer
  • 设备类型:CUDA / CPU(根据可用性自动切换)

💻 系统信息

  • 操作系统:Ubuntu 20.04 LTS
  • Python 版本:3.9
  • CPU 核心数:8
  • 内存总量:32GB,可用:18.5GB

此页面有助于判断是否启用 GPU 加速以及资源占用情况。


5. 性能表现与硬件建议

5.1 不同硬件下的处理效率对比

配置等级GPU 型号显存平均处理速度(倍实时)
基础GTX 16606GB~3x
推荐RTX 306012GB~5x
优秀RTX 409024GB~6x

注:RTF_avg = 处理耗时 / 音频时长,数值越小越好。RTF=0.2 表示处理速度为 5 倍实时。

5.2 典型音频处理时间参考

音频时长预期处理时间(GPU)预期处理时间(CPU)
1 分钟10–12 秒30–40 秒
3 分钟30–36 秒90–120 秒
5 分钟50–60 秒150–200 秒

建议优先使用具备 CUDA 支持的 NVIDIA 显卡以充分发挥模型性能。


6. 常见问题与优化技巧

6.1 常见问题解答

Q1:识别结果不准确怎么办?

A:尝试以下优化措施:

  • 添加热词提升专业术语识别率
  • 使用 16kHz 采样率的 WAV/FLAC 格式音频
  • 避免背景音乐、回声或多人同时讲话
  • 在安静环境下录制原始音频

Q2:支持哪些音频格式?

A:支持以下格式:

  • ✅ 推荐:.wav,.flac(无损压缩,识别质量最高)
  • ⚠️ 可用:.mp3,.m4a,.aac,.ogg(有损压缩,质量略低)

Q3:能否导出识别结果?

A:目前可通过界面上的复制按钮手动复制文本内容,粘贴至 Word、Notepad++ 等工具保存。后续版本有望支持自动导出 TXT/PDF 文件。

Q4:如何提高长音频识别稳定性?

A:建议将超过 5 分钟的音频切分为小于 300 秒的小段后再上传,避免内存不足导致中断。


6.2 实用优化技巧

技巧 1:合理设置热词
  • 数量控制在 10 个以内
  • 优先添加易错的专业术语、人名、品牌名
  • 示例(科技类):
    大模型,LLM,Transformer,注意力机制,微调
技巧 2:批量处理前统一格式转换

使用 FFmpeg 批量转换音频为 16kHz WAV 格式:

for file in *.mp3; do ffmpeg -i "$file" -ar 16000 -ac 1 "${file%.mp3}.wav" done
技巧 3:利用实时录音做语音草稿

开启「实时录音」Tab,边说边识别,可用于撰写文章初稿、会议要点速记等场景。

技巧 4:检查设备权限与网络连接

确保 Docker 容器已正确挂载音频设备,且未被其他程序占用;若远程访问失败,请检查防火墙设置和端口映射。


7. 总结

通过Speech Seaco Paraformer ASR 阿里中文语音识别模型 构建by科哥这一镜像,我们实现了对达摩院先进 ASR 技术的“平民化”应用。无需配置环境、无需编写代码、无需理解底层原理,普通用户也能在几分钟内搭建起一个高精度、支持热词定制的中文语音识别系统。

其核心价值体现在三个方面:

  1. 极简部署:一行命令启动,告别复杂依赖;
  2. 专业级能力:基于 SeACoParaformer 的热词增强机制,显著提升垂直领域识别准确率;
  3. 全场景覆盖:支持单文件、批量、实时三种识别模式,满足多样化需求。

无论是企业用户希望快速构建会议纪要系统,还是个人开发者想探索语音交互应用,这款镜像都提供了开箱即用的理想起点。

未来可期待的功能扩展包括:

  • 自动标点恢复
  • 多语言混合识别
  • 角色分离(Speaker Diarization)
  • API 接口开放供第三方调用

现在即可体验这一强大工具,开启你的语音智能之旅。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/18 6:28:23

Qwen2.5-0.5B部署案例:医疗问答系统

Qwen2.5-0.5B部署案例&#xff1a;医疗问答系统 1. 引言 随着大模型技术的快速发展&#xff0c;如何在资源受限的边缘设备上实现高效、可靠的AI推理成为关键挑战。特别是在医疗领域&#xff0c;实时性、隐私保护和本地化部署需求尤为突出。传统的大型语言模型往往需要高性能G…

作者头像 李华
网站建设 2026/4/15 10:37:38

BongoCat桌面宠物终极指南:打造专属的实时互动键盘伴侣

BongoCat桌面宠物终极指南&#xff1a;打造专属的实时互动键盘伴侣 【免费下载链接】BongoCat 让呆萌可爱的 Bongo Cat 陪伴你的键盘敲击与鼠标操作&#xff0c;每一次输入都充满趣味与活力&#xff01; 项目地址: https://gitcode.com/gh_mirrors/bong/BongoCat 在数字…

作者头像 李华
网站建设 2026/4/18 6:28:54

Libre Barcode:零代码生成专业条码的开源字体方案

Libre Barcode&#xff1a;零代码生成专业条码的开源字体方案 【免费下载链接】librebarcode Libre Barcode: barcode fonts for various barcode standards. 项目地址: https://gitcode.com/gh_mirrors/li/librebarcode 还在为复杂的条码生成工具而烦恼吗&#xff1f;L…

作者头像 李华
网站建设 2026/4/18 6:31:25

Qwen1.5-0.5B-Chat实战教程:ModelScope集成一键部署方案

Qwen1.5-0.5B-Chat实战教程&#xff1a;ModelScope集成一键部署方案 1. 引言 1.1 学习目标 本文旨在为开发者提供一份完整、可落地的 Qwen1.5-0.5B-Chat 模型本地化部署指南。通过本教程&#xff0c;您将掌握如何基于 ModelScope&#xff08;魔塔社区&#xff09;生态&#…

作者头像 李华
网站建设 2026/4/15 16:20:49

批量处理进度卡住?可能是因为这3个原因

批量处理进度卡住&#xff1f;可能是因为这3个原因 在使用 Fun-ASR 进行大规模语音识别任务时&#xff0c;许多用户反馈“批量处理进度卡住”、“长时间无响应”或“中途突然停止”。这类问题不仅影响工作效率&#xff0c;还可能导致资源浪费和任务中断。尽管系统界面显示“正…

作者头像 李华
网站建设 2026/4/16 16:16:51

3分钟掌握Zotero GB/T 7714-2015参考文献格式配置全攻略

3分钟掌握Zotero GB/T 7714-2015参考文献格式配置全攻略 【免费下载链接】Chinese-STD-GB-T-7714-related-csl GB/T 7714相关的csl以及Zotero使用技巧及教程。 项目地址: https://gitcode.com/gh_mirrors/chi/Chinese-STD-GB-T-7714-related-csl 还在为论文参考文献格式…

作者头像 李华